An assignment of oil and gas lease is a contractual agreement between a landowner and an oil or gas company in which the company gains the right to explore for, develop, and produce oil and gas from the property.
The lessee of an oil or gas lease can assign the entire lease or part of it. In other words, the lessee can sell or transfer part of the estate or the entire estate to which they have the working rights. The assignee is assigned the working interest and lease obligations, including override royalty.
Operating rights are defined in the federal onshore regulations as the interest created out of a lease authorizing the holder of that right to enter upon the lease lands to conduct drilling and related operations, including production of oil or gas from such lands in ance with the terms of the lease.
